surveying and hiring
Wednesday, August 15, 2007, 00:35:00 GMT by alexis [kn0thing]
About a year ago, we ran a survey of our users on behalf of Federated Media. They wanted demographic data and we were kinda curious to learn about our users. Our new employers need an updated look at who users are and we're still kinda curious. And we think you might be, too. We worked with them to keep the survey short and we're going to share the more interesting results with you. If you're interested, here's the survey . If not, maybe you need a new job.

who "discovered" xkcd?
Thursday, July 19, 2007, 03:01:00 GMT by alexis [kn0thing]
Riding the subway with a friend of mine, he asked what the first xkcd post on reddit was. We at reddit like to think our community helped boost those splendid stick figures into geek fame. But I had no idea who submitted the first xkcd comic to reddit. I know, it's discovery in the same way Columbus "discovered" America - just work with us, please. When these sorts of questions come up, we can always rely on Chris "Statman" Slowe to divine the answer from our logs.
